122,152,532,107 is an odd composite number composed of two prime numbers multiplied together.

What does the number 122152532107 look like?

This visualization shows the relationship between its 2 prime factors (large circles) and 4 divisors.

122152532107 is an odd composite number. It is composed of two distinct prime numbers multiplied together. It has a total of four divisors.

Prime factorization of 122152532107:

67 × 1823172121
